What Is a Life Path Number?
Your life path number is a single digit — or, in rarer cases, a "master number" (11, 22, or 33) — calculated entirely from your date of birth. In numerology, it's considered the closest thing to a personal blueprint: it points to your core purpose, your natural strengths, and the lessons you're here to learn in this lifetime.
Think of it as the headline of your numerology chart. Other numbers — soul urge, personality, expression — add detail and nuance, but the life path number sets the overall theme.
How to Calculate Your Life Path Number
The calculation is simple: add every digit of your birth date together, then keep reducing the total until you reach a single digit — unless you land on 11, 22, or 33, in which case you stop.

Master Numbers: 11, 22, and 33
If your calculation lands on 11, 22, or 33, you don't reduce further — these are "master numbers," and numerology treats them as carrying amplified, more intense energy than their single-digit counterparts (11 relates to 2, 22 to 4, 33 to 6).
Master numbers are statistically rarer and are often described as carrying both greater potential and greater inner tension. If you have one, you'll usually feel the difference: a heightened sensitivity, a stronger pull toward purpose, and — for many people — a sense that life asks a bit more of them.
Does Your Life Path Number Determine Your Future?
No — and this is worth being honest about. A life path number is best understood as a lens, not a fixed destiny. It describes tendencies, natural strengths, and recurring themes you may notice in your life, not events that are guaranteed to happen.
Two people can share the same life path number and lead very different lives, shaped by their choices, their upbringing, and countless other factors. What numerology offers is self-awareness — a framework for understanding your own patterns, not a script you're locked into.
Life Path Number vs. Other Numerology Numbers
Life path number gets the most attention, but it's only one piece of a full numerology reading. Here's how it relates to the others:
- Life path number (from your birth date) — your core purpose and life direction.
- Soul urge number (from the vowels in your name) — your deepest inner desires.
- Personality number (from the consonants in your name) — the image you project outward.
- Expression number (from your full name) — your natural talents and potential.
